    Abstract:

    The orthogonal experiment of thermophilic aerobic fermentation of sick and dead pigs was conducted to optimize the parameters for thermophilic aerobic fermentation of sick and dead pigs.The sick and dead pigs was used as materials,sawdust as additives,and the ratios of additives,fermentation temperature and ventilation rate as factors,and the losses of carbon and nitrogen and the total intensity of odor as indexes.The components of organic malodorous substances in exhaust gas were analyzed and their emission concentrations were determined.The concentrations of ammonia and carbon dioxide were detected as well.The effects of the ratios of additives,fermentation temperature and ventilation rate on the loss of carbon and nitrogen and the emission of odor were analyzed with range and contribution rate analysis.The results showed that 18 organic malodorous substances in total including 3 sulfur compounds,1 alkane compound,12 aromatic hydrocarbon compounds,1 phenolic compound and 1 inorganic compound were detected qualitatively and quantitatively after thermophilic aerobic fermentation for sick and dead pig with sawdust as additives.Among them,p-cresol,methanethiol,dimethyl sulfide,dimethyl disulfide and ammonia were identified as the main source of odor.The factors affecting the loss of carbon and nitrogen were in the decreasing order of additives ratios>ventilation rate>temperature.The factors affecting the total odor intensity were in the decreasing order of temperature> additives ratios> ventilation rate.Considering the loss of carbon and nitrogen and the total intensity of odor comprehensively,the optimized parameters for thermophilic aerobic fermentation of sick and dead pigs are as follows:the additives ratios of 1∶5.5,the fermentation temperature of 55 ℃,and the ventilation rate of 14 L/(L·min).
